How to Choose the Right Problem-Solving Stacking Toy

When selecting the perfect problem-solving stacking toy for your child, consider their age and development stage. Young infants may benefit from softer, easily graspable blocks, while older toddlers might be ready for more complex, multilevel stacking challenges. It’s essential to assess not only the child’s current abilities but also their interests. If your little one is a fan of animals, opting for stacking toys that incorporate animal shapes might spark even more engagement.

Another factor to think about is the material used in the toys. Many parents prefer wooden stacking toys for their durability and classic appeal, but vibrant plastic options can also capture a child’s attention effectively. If you envision playtime involving plenty of creative stacking and potential falling towers, consider a material that will withstand the frequent tumbles of energetic play. Don’t forget to check for safety certifications. Toys made with non-toxic materials and without small, choking hazards provide peace of mind during playtime.

Lastly, don’t overlook the importance of versatility in a stacking toy. A toy that can grow with your child, offering various ways to play and learn, is usually a wiser investment. For instance, some stacking toys allow children to create patterns or even incorporate numbers or letters, extending their usability as your child grows. When making a decision, envision how the toy will fit into your child’s daily play routine and promote continual learning.

1. Age Appropriateness

One of the first things you’ll want to consider is the age of the child you’re buying for. Different toys cater to different age groups, and it’s essential to choose one that matches the development stage of the child. For instance, younger toddlers, around 12 to 18 months, often prefer simpler stacking toys with large pieces that are easy to grasp. Look for toys that specifically mention age suitability to ensure you’re getting the right fit.

As children grow, their cognitive and motor skills evolve, allowing them to handle more complex toys. For preschoolers or children aged 3 to 5 years, consider stacking toys with varied shapes, sizes, or even those that incorporate problem-solving elements like puzzles. This sets a solid foundation for their learning and fine motor skills while keeping the play engaging.

2. Material Quality

When it comes to toys, the materials used can make all the difference. You’ll want to look for stacking toys made from high-quality, safe materials that can withstand a bit of wear and tear. Wooden toys are a hit with many parents because they’re durable, long-lasting, and often more environmentally friendly than their plastic counterparts.

Be sure to check for certifications and safety standards. Non-toxic paint and finishes are key if you’re considering wooden stacking toys. Similarly, if you’re looking at plastic options, ensure they’re BPA-free and tested for safety. Quality materials mean the toy will not only last longer but also keep your mind at ease while your child plays.

What are stacking toys and how do they help with problem-solving skills?

Stacking toys are engaging, often colorful toys that encourage children to stack various shapes or objects on top of one another. They come in many forms, including blocks, rings, and even more elaborate designs. The core idea is to promote fine motor skills while introducing concepts of balance and spatial awareness, which are essential components of problem-solving. As kids play with these toys, they experiment with different configurations, learning which shapes fit together and how to maintain stability.

Through the process of stacking, children encounter challenges and learn to think critically about how to overcome them. For instance, they might realize that a wider base will provide more stability for their stack, or they may find out the hard way that a tall structure is more likely to tumble. This trial-and-error approach enhances their cognitive skills and builds resilience as they discover solutions to their challenges.

At what age are stacking toys most beneficial for children?

Stacking toys are generally suitable for a wide range of ages, but they are most beneficial for infants and toddlers, roughly from six months to three years old. During these formative years, children are developing essential motor skills and cognitive understanding, and stacking toys provide the perfect platform for this growth. At six months, they can start to explore different textures and shapes, while toddlers can engage in more complex stacking challenges that really get those problem-solving skills going.

However, that doesn’t mean older children won’t enjoy stacking toys! Preschoolers and even elementary-aged kids can benefit from more advanced stacking sets that promote creativity and encourage new challenges. Parents often find that as children grow, they continue to enjoy these toys in different ways, whether that’s through imaginative play or collaborative building games with friends.

What features should I look for when buying stacking toys?

When shopping for stacking toys, consider materials, size, and design as key features. Choose toys made from safe, durable materials like wood or BPA-free plastic to ensure safety during play. The size of the pieces matters too; they should be large enough to prevent choking hazards yet small enough for little hands to manipulate easily. A good stacking toy also has a range of shapes and colors, which not only attracts attention but also stimulates creativity and sensory exploration.

Additionally, look for toys that evolve with your child’s skills. For example, if the toy has interchangeable pieces or multi-functional aspects, it can provide varied challenges over time. Some toys may even incorporate sound or light features for added engagement, which can enhance the overall play experience and keep your child interested longer.

Are there any safety concerns with stacking toys?

Absolutely, safety is paramount when it comes to children’s toys! Always check that the stacking toys are made from non-toxic materials and are age-appropriate to minimize any risks of choking or injury. Reputable manufacturers will often provide safety certifications, so it’s wise to look for toys that meet established safety standards. Moreover, if the toy has any small removable parts, it should be clearly labeled for older toddlers or preschoolers only.

When introducing new toys, it’s also good practice for parents to supervise play initially. This provides an opportunity to teach children safe ways to play and stack while monitoring for any small pieces that might get loose. By taking these precautions, you can create a safe and fun play environment where your child can thrive and explore freely.
